Sir Bobby Charlton To David Moyes
Sir Bobby Charlton: We have secured a person who has a long-term commitment. He is David Moyes
"I've always said that we wanted the next manager to be 'genuine Manchester United man',"
"In self-David Moyes, we have someone who understands the things that makes this such a special club. We have secured a man who is committed to the long term and will build a team for the future as well as now. Stability breeds success."
"David has a tremendous strength of character and recognizes the importance of bringing young players and develop them with world-class talent. At United, I think David would be able to express himself. I am delighted he has accepted and I can not wait to work with him."
David Moyes said
David Moyes: It's a great honor.
"It is a great honor to be asked to be the next manager of Manchester United. I am delighted that Sir Alex recommended me for the job. I respect everything he has done and for the Football Club [Manchester United].
"I know how hard it is to follow the footsteps of the best managers ever, but the opportunity to deal with Manchester United does not happen often and I am really looking forward to taking that position next season."
"I have a great job at Everton, with an outstanding chairman and the Board of Directors and a set of great players. Between now and the end of the season, I will do everything in my power to make sure our [Everton] ended the season with the highest possible position. "
"Fantastic Fans Everton have played a big role in making my years at Everton so much fun and I thank them wholeheartedly for the support they have given to me and the players. Everton will be close to me for the rest of my life."
TO David Moyes From Sir Alex Ferguson
Sir Alex Ferguson: David Moyes has all the qualities that we expect!
"When we discussed the candidates who we feel have the exact attributes we agreed David Moyes,"
"David is a man of great integrity with a strong work ethic."
"I admired his work for a long time and approached him in 1998 to discuss the position of assistant manager here."
"He was young when he started his career and has done a remarkable job at Everton. There is no question. He has all the qualities that we expect from a manager at the club."
